Netflix Brings You ‘Dang!’, a New Adult Animated Series Featuring Stephanie Hsu, Poppy Liu, and Andrew Law from ‘The Good Place’ Team
Netflix has officially ordered a series of the adult animated comedy Dang!, featuring the collaborative talents of The Good Place alumni Andrew Law, Matt Murray, and Mike Schur as executive producers. Law is set to star alongside Stephanie Hsu, known for her roles in Everything Everywhere All at Once and The Rocky Horror Show, and Poppy Liu, recognized for her work in His & Hers and Hacks. The series is produced by Universal Television, with animation provided by Titmouse, and is expected to premiere later this year.
Written by Law and Murray, who will serve as showrunners, Dang! revolves around a brother (Law) and sister (Liu) navigating their chaotic lives in New York City, only to have their world disrupted by a visit from their high-achieving older sister (Hsu).
Schur, who has a longstanding collaborative history with Law and Murray, has been deeply involved in the creative development of the series. The executive production team also includes Alan Yang (Master of None), David Miner from 3Arts Entertainment, Chris Prynoski (The Legend of Vox Machina), Shannon Prynoski (Scavengers Reign), Ben Kalina (Big Mouth), and Antonio Canobbio (Digman) from Titmouse. Universal Television, part of the Universal Studio Group, oversees the production, where Schur currently holds an overall deal.

John Derderian, Netflix’s VP of Animation Series + Kids & Family TV, expressed enthusiasm about the project, stating, “Mike Schur, Andrew Law, and Matt Murray are experts in finding the heart and hilarity in the most complex relationships. With Dang!, they tackle the relatable chaos of sibling rivalry, brought to life by the undeniable chemistry of Andrew Law, Poppy Liu, and Stephanie Hsu. As the home for the best creators and adult animated series, we’re thrilled to bring this incredible team and new show to our global audience.”
Schur and Murray’s previous collaborations include prominent series such as Saturday Night Live, Parks and Recreation, and Brooklyn Nine-Nine, along with Murray’s co-creation of Sunnyside and Schur’s latest Netflix project, A Man in the Inside. Law has also contributed to Hacks, which Schur executive produces.
Law expressed excitement about the partnership, remarking, “We’re beyond thrilled to partner with Netflix, Universal Television, and Titmouse on Dang!. We hope that you fall in love with these characters. Or at least find them very, very attractive. Sexually.”
Dang! joins a robust lineup of upcoming adult animated comedies on Netflix, including Strip Law, Mating Season, Alley Cats, and the second seasons of Haunted Hotel and Long Story Short.
